O R D E R
The order passed under Section 87 of the Tamil Nadu Cooperative Societies Act imposing surcharge vide proceedings No. 5/2006-2007, dated 14.01.2008 is under challenge in this writ petition. Consequent attachment order, dated 10.05.2010 is also under challenge.
2. Heard Mr. Sidhardhan, learned Counsel appearing for the petitioner, Mr.M.Muthu, lear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the respondents.
3.An order of surcharge passed under Section 87 of the Tamil Nadu Cooperative Societies Act is an appealable order under Section 152 of the Tamil Nadu Cooperative Societies Act. The writ petitioner has rightly preferred an appeal in C.M.A. CS.No.20 of 2010 before the Cooperative Tribunal/ Principal District Judge, Tirunelveli.
4.However, it is stated by the learned Counsel that the present writ petition has been filed in view of the order of attachment passed. There cannot be any two parallel proceedings in respect of the order passed under section 87 of the Tamil Nadu Cooperative Societies Act.
5.The learned Counsel for the petitioner is not aware of the fact whether the CMA CS No.20 of 2010 is pending or not. However, the writ petition is filed during the pendency of the CMA CS No.20 of 2010 and therefore, the same cannot be entertained. The writ petition itself was filed on 30.06.2011 after a lapse of about three and a half years from the date of passing of the order in surcharge proceedings, dated 14.01.2008.
6.For all these reasons, the writ petition cannot be entertained and the writ petitioner has to pursue the remedy before
appropriate competent Court in C.M.A. CS.No.20 of 2010, which was already filed. Thus, no further adjudication is required in this writ petition.
7.Accordingly, the writ petition stands dismissed. However, there shall be no order as to costs. Consequently, connected miscellaneous petition is closed.
